The town of Juan Rincón belongs to the municipality of Victoria (State of Tamaulipas). There are 728 inhabitants and it is 234 meters altitude.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#8 of the ranking.

Data: In Juan Rincón, there is a percentage of 0% of indigenous population and 94% of the households have a cell phone. Need more statistics on Juan Rincón? They are at the bottom of this page.

Do you want to locate the town of Juan Rincón? You can find it at 22.0 kilometers, in direction South, from the town of Ciudad Victoria, which has the largest population within the municipality. #2 The population of Juan Rincón (Tamaulipas) is 728 inhabitants

Population data in Juan Rincón
YearFemale InhabitantsMale inhabitantsTotal population
2020358370728
2010310333643
2005241273514

Other demographic data in Juan Rincón:
20202010
Fertility rate (children per woman):2.584.80
Population coming from outside the State of Tamaulipas:5.91%7.00%
Illiterate population:3.02%4.98%
Illiterate population (men):1.79%4.80%
Illiterate population (women):1.24%5.16%
Schooling level:7.416.38
Schooling level (men):7.266.27
Schooling level (women):7.576.50

Unemployment, economy and dwelling data in Juan Rincón:
20202010
Employed population over 12 years:32.14%34.37%
Employed population over 12 years (men):55.41%59.16%
Employed population over 12 years (women):8.10%7.74%
Number of inhabited private dwellings:177158
Homes with electricity:99.44%99.33%
Housing with piped water:99.44%98.66%
Dwellings with toilet or sanitary facilities:44.63%100.00%
Dwellings with radio:55.37%63.09%
Housing with television:92.66%83.89%
Housing with refrigerator:94.92%92.62%
Housing with washing machine:87.01%75.84%
Housing with automobile:73.45%59.73%
Households with personal computer, laptop or tablet:9.04%0.67%
Homes with landline telephone:2.82%22.15%
Dwellings with cellular phones:94.35%60.40%
Homes with Internet:29.94%0.00%
